Title :
Use of the Bubnov-Galerkin method to skin effect problems for the case of unknown boundary conditions

Abstract :
A method based on coupling the Bubnov-Galerkin method and the separation of variables method is described for the solution of alternating field problems in which the region of prime interest is embedded in an infinitely extending region where Laplace´s equation holds. The proposed method can also be used when the stored energy associated with the exterior region and the boundary conditions at infinity are infinite. As an example illustrating the use of the method, the inner impedance of an elliptic conductor is calculated. By means of iterative numerical processes, the method enables the exact values of impedance to be obtained.
